• 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:他のアプリケーションがサーバーを使用しているため)

他のアプリケーションがサーバーを使用しているためこの操作を完了できません

このQ&Aのポイント
  • 他のアプリケーションがサーバーを使用しているため、操作を完了できません
  • エラーメッセージの意味と起こっていることについて教えてください
  • 回避策についてもご教授お願いします

質問者が選んだベストアンサー

  • ベストアンサー
  • seazzz
  • ベストアンサー率100% (1/1)
回答No.1

下記のリンク先も同様の問題を抱えているように見えます。 # 質問内容から読み取れませんが。 http://hanatyan.sakura.ne.jp/vb60bbs/wforum.cgi?no=10027&reno=no&oya=10027&mode=msgview&page=60 質問内容で環境の説明をするのは良いと思いますが、 環境のバージョンもそうですが、一体どういったデータをどのように処理したのか明確に書けるとGoodです。 VBとExcelを使用しているならバージョンは? 現象はプログラムがどのような処理をしている時に起こる? 再現性はあるか? 等々です。 ご自分が質問を受けている立場で読み返してみてはいかがでしょう。

hk1388
質問者

補足

・VBはVB6、EXCELは2007 ・過去1ヶ月で2回発生しました。 ・再現性はありません。 現象 ・VBで作成したFormからデータ入力し、EXCEL.CSVファイルへデータを書き出す処理で発生しています。Formをクリックしたタイミングで発生しているようです。 また、EXCELの起動で下記コーディングをしています。 Public Function ExecExcel(para As String) As Boolean '** Excel 起動 On Local Error Resume Next Set exl = CreateObject("Excel.Application") Shell exl.Path & "\excel.exe " & para, 1 If Err <> 0 Then ExecExcel = False Else ExecExcel = True End If On Local Error GoTo 0 End Function 上記コーディングは、“オブジェクト生成と、Sellでの起動は、それぞれ別々に動いていることになる”、という投稿を目にしたことがあります。このコーディングがまずいのでしょうか? 教えてください。 seazzzさん、貴重なコメントありがとうございました。

関連するQ&A

専門家に質問してみよう